City Guide
Shenjiamen, Zhejiang, China
Overview
Shenjiamen is a lively coastal town on Zhoushan Island, Zhejiang, renowned for its rich fishing heritage, busy seafood markets, and stunning harbor views. The city pairs a traditional marine culture with modern development, attracting seafood lovers and island-hoppers alike.
Best Time to Visit
April to June or September to November for mild and pleasant weather.
Local Tips
Visit the Shenjiamen seafood night market for fresh catches; bring cash as many small vendors do not accept cards. Ferries to nearby islands can get crowded, so arrive early, especially on weekends.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is not customary in China. Dress modestly, especially when visiting temples or fishing communities. It is polite to greet with a nod or slight bow.
Safety Warnings
Pickpocketing can occur in crowded markets and ferry terminals, keep your belongings close. Be cautious around busy piers and avoid swimming near fishing boats.
Hidden Gems
Explore the quiet fishermen's wharf at sunrise, hike Putuo Mountain for panoramic island views, and discover the tranquil Lincheng ancient alleyways for local snacks.
